Assistant Project Manager (Architect / Interior Designer)

Whitsitt Interiors + Architecture is a firm dedicated to exceeding expectations through exceptional design solutions. The Assistant Project Manager will assist project teams in completing deliverables on schedule and effectively implement design intent while developing their career and supporting team goals.

Responsibilities

Assist one or more project teams through each project phase to successfully complete deliverables on schedule
Assist in managing project schedules and project production
Assist in surveying existing conditions at various project sites
Assist in developing the design of each project via charrettes, ideation, and collaboration
Produce construction documents and other project deliverables in Revit
Coordinate with consultants, vendors, and industry partners
Prepare project presentations in InDesign
Participate in client meetings
Assist in construction administration by reviewing project submittals and shop drawings, and by working with consultants, contractors, and vendors to actively maintain the project schedule
Assist in tracking construction progress by visiting active construction sites, attending construction meetings, generating punch lists, and reviewing, photographing, and documenting construction progress
Track and manage your individual time and performance on projects
Work with leadership to develop your career
Actively pursue industry knowledge
Set and achieve individual goals
Impart what you have learned to others
Actively support team members and progress firm goals

Required

2-5 years of experience in delivering commercial projects
Professional degree (Master's or Bachelor's) in Architecture or Interior Design from an accredited program
Licensed or actively working towards licensure
Knowledge of and familiarity with architectural and interior design principles and practices
Knowledge of and familiarity with building codes and structures
Experience in and familiarity with the basic phases of project delivery
Proficiency in Revit, InDesign, Bluebeam Revu, and Microsoft Word
Experience in or familiarity with AutoCAD, Photoshop, Microsoft Outlook, and Excel

Preferred

Experience in or familiarity with other Adobe Creative Cloud Suite programs
Experience in or familiarity with Microsoft Teams
Experience in or familiarity with Procore
Experience in training team members
Experience in leading teams
Experience in presenting project deliverables to clients
